Contract Manager (Voids)

Are you a confident, proactive Contract Manager who thrives in a fast-paced environment and is passionate about delivering excellent property services? Join our Repairs Team and play a key role in delivering high-quality void works, helping us get homes ready for customers quickly, safely and to the right standard.

As a Contract Manager, you’ll take the lead on managing the performance of our void contractors, supporting strategic contract administration, and driving continuous service improvements. You’ll work closely with operational teams and stakeholders to ensure quality, value for money, and a great customer experience.

What you’ll be doing:

  • Managing contractor performance, ensuring void works are delivered on time, within budget and to a high standard
  • Monitoring work in progress, resolving issues and ensuring completion targets are achieved
  • Supporting operational teams and holding contractors to account for quality and performance
  • Leading review meetings and identifying opportunities for service improvement
  • Acting as a point of escalation for complaints and performance issues
  • Using data and insight to support proactive service delivery and decision-making
  • Building strong relationships with internal teams, contractors and stakeholders
  • Supporting risk management, audits and compliance activities

What we’re looking for:

We’re looking for someone who can demonstrate the following essential criteria:

  • Proven Contract Management Experience – experience managing contractor performance, KPIs and resolving escalations
  • Strong Communication and Stakeholder Skills – able to build relationships and challenge constructively when needed
  • Commercial Awareness – confident managing budgets, forecasts and value for money
  • Initiative and Problem-Solving Ability – able to make sound decisions and drive improvements
  • Organisational and Prioritisation Skills – able to manage competing priorities in a fast-paced environment
  • Customer-Focused and Collaborative Approach – committed to delivering great outcomes and promoting a “one team” culture
  • Relevant Property Knowledge – understanding of property maintenance, compliance and Health & Safety

Please read: You will need to have experience overseeing several contractors simultaneously, managing the delivery of a large programme of void property repairs and refurbishments across multiple locations. You'll be confident in driving performance, maintaining quality standards, and ensuring homes are ready for re-let efficiently and safely.
